Job Description
Main Job Tasks and Responsibilities
answer, screen and transfer inbound phone calls
receive and direct visitors and clients
general clerical duties including photocopying, fax and mailing
maintain electronic and hard copy filing system
retrieve documents from filing system
handle requests for information and data
resolve administrative problems and inquiries
prepare written responses to routine enquiries
prepare and modify documents including correspondence, reports, drafts, memos and emails
schedule and coordinate meetings, appointments and travel arrangements for managers or supervisors
prepare agendas for meetings and prepare schedules
record, compile, transcribe and distribute minutes of meetings
open, sort and distribute incoming correspondence
maintain office supply inventories
coordinate maintenance of office equipment


Key Competencies
communication skills - written and verbal
planning and organizing
prioritizing
problem assessment and problem solving
information gathering and information monitoring
attention to detail and accuracy
flexibility
adaptability
customer service orientation
teamwork
Requirements
Education and Experience
computer skills and knowledge of relevant software
knowledge of operation of standard office equipment.
knowledge of clerical and administrative procedures and systems such as filing and record keeping
knowledge of principles and practices of basic office management
knowledge of mortgage loan processing
series 7 and 63 securities license preferred

Fraud Tips:
  • Research the company before submitting your resume or personal information to them.
  • If the company is asking you to cash checks and wire money back to them then the job is a scam.
  • Listen to your instincts. Does something seem odd in the job posting or in your comminucations with the company? Is it too good to be true?
